Output ea090d393ff81ca4cc5230e2726123762ebd489c26d04d85fb5bb331e5d57ffa:0

value
91368844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ebbf639c9369c2e684ad990ee08080e2f6860c32 OP_EQUAL
address
3PBXza9JDPfJuc3bSQv5jtE1ZghFDC8d7M
transaction
ea090d393ff81ca4cc5230e2726123762ebd489c26d04d85fb5bb331e5d57ffa
confirmations
493815
spent
true